This restaurant offers a cozy, romantic atmosphere with booth tables enclosed by decorative walls and matching curtains, creating intimate dining spaces ideal for gluten-free diners seeking comfort and privacy. The staff strives to accommodate gluten intolerance, enhancing the welcoming experience.

I will preface with Food was very good. The service was fair. They were all nice but the boy bussing the table would take away food far too quickly when we were still eating it. He wouldn’t ask and he did it several times. He was very nice, but determined to clean that table! Paying was another struggle. They do not split a check more than 2 ways. They offered to split 3 ways, but it was overly complicated. Good food, fair service, but they were nice. We had one person with a severe dairy allergy and one with gluten intolerance (not preference). They tried to accommodate but were not well informed of allergies.

Found Aya Sofia in 2018 and went there for our first Valentine's Day with my then-girlfriend-now-wife. Been going for special occasions ever since, hands down one of my Top 3 favorite restaurants in the St. Louis metro area. Never had anything that wasn't absolutely delicious! Highly recommend the Sigara Boregi for a starter and and Manti for a main. Lamb Shank is one of the best I've ever had and only $30 for a portion that could feed two people. And almost the whole menu is available gluten-free, just as an aside.
